The longest mountain range in the U.S. is the Rocky Mountains. The tallest is the Alaska Range, which is where Mt. McKinley (also known as Denali), the tallest mountain in North America is located.

Mt Vesuvius is located in the southern portion of the Apennine mountain range. This mountain chain extends throughout peninsular Italy.
The Atlas Mountains are the principal mountain range of northwest Africa, stretching across Morocco, Algeria, and Tunisia. These mountains are known for their rugged beauty and diverse ecosystems, including alpine forests and high plateaus.

The Sierra Madre Oriental is the largest mountain range in northeastern Mexico. The Sierra Madres, which means mother mountain range, is made up of several more mountain ranges throughout Mexico, Central America, and the United States.

A row of mountains is called a mountain range. This term refers to a series of connected mountains or hills that form a continuous elevated line. Mountain ranges can span great distances and often have distinct peaks and valleys.
